Overview of Asahikawa Medical University

Asahikawa Medical University (AMU) is a prominent national public institution founded in 1973, located in Asahikawa, Hokkaido, Japan. Established with a mission to improve healthcare in northern Japan and promote medical science advancement, AMU has grown into a comprehensive, research-intensive university. The institution serves approximately 1,200 undergraduate and 250 postgraduate students, supported by a dedicated faculty of over 270 members. Its single, well-resourced campus provides a close-knit academic community dedicated to both teaching excellence and impactful research. The university’s credible history, regional significance, and governmental backing underscore its role as a leader in medical education and public health in Japan.
